Art Educator for Children, Seniors, and Families
Serving Communities Through MOCA, Public Schools, Senior Centers, and Libraries
Yu is an experienced art educator. She serves as a teaching artist at the Museum of Chinese in America and at public libraries, where she leads workshops in Chinese art, arts and crafts, and creative techniques. At MOCA, she leads the MOCACreate family program, engaging visitors of all ages in hands-on art experiences that celebrate Chinese culture.

Educational Art Game For AAPI
“Build Your Own Chinatown” is an art game created by Yu for kids. Through engaging in artistic activities such as practicing Chinese art, designing clothings, and sculpturing pots and vases, kids not only create but also learn about the rich cultural heritage of China.
